2025-11-23T09:37:17.053116

Operator Learning for Power Systems Simulation

Schlegel, Taylor, Farrokhabadi
Time domain simulation, i.e., modeling the system's evolution over time, is a crucial tool for studying and enhancing power system stability and dynamic performance. However, these simulations become computationally intractable for renewable-penetrated grids, due to the small simulation time step required to capture renewable energy resources' ultra-fast dynamic phenomena in the range of 1-50 microseconds. This creates a critical need for solutions that are both fast and scalable, posing a major barrier for the stable integration of renewable energy resources and thus climate change mitigation. This paper explores operator learning, a family of machine learning methods that learn mappings between functions, as a surrogate model for these costly simulations. The paper investigates, for the first time, the fundamental concept of simulation time step-invariance, which enables models trained on coarse time steps to generalize to fine-resolution dynamics. Three operator learning methods are benchmarked on a simple test system that, while not incorporating practical complexities of renewable-penetrated grids, serves as a first proof-of-concept to demonstrate the viability of time step-invariance. Models are evaluated on (i) zero-shot super-resolution, where training is performed on a coarse simulation time step and inference is performed at super-resolution, and (ii) generalization between stable and unstable dynamic regimes. This work addresses a key challenge in the integration of renewable energy for the mitigation of climate change by benchmarking operator learning methods to model physical systems.
academic

Apprendimento di Operatori per la Simulazione di Sistemi Elettrici

Informazioni Fondamentali

  • ID Articolo: 2510.09704
  • Titolo: Operator Learning for Power Systems Simulation
  • Autori: Matthew Schlegel (University of Calgary), Matthew E. Taylor (University of Alberta), Mostafa Farrokhabadi (University of Calgary)
  • Classificazione: cs.LG
  • Data di Pubblicazione/Conferenza: NeurIPS 2025 Workshop on Tackling Climate Change with Machine Learning
  • Link Articolo: https://arxiv.org/abs/2510.09704

Riassunto

La simulazione nel dominio del tempo (ossia la modellazione dell'evoluzione del sistema nel tempo) è uno strumento essenziale per lo studio e il miglioramento della stabilità e delle prestazioni dinamiche dei sistemi elettrici. Tuttavia, per le reti con elevata penetrazione di energie rinnovabili, queste simulazioni diventano computazionalmente non fattibili a causa della necessità di passi temporali di simulazione estremamente piccoli (1-50 microsecondi) per catturare i fenomeni dinamici ultrarapidi delle energie rinnovabili. Questo articolo esplora l'apprendimento di operatori come modello surrogato per queste simulazioni costose, investigando per la prima volta il concetto fondamentale di invarianza del passo temporale di simulazione, che consente ai modelli addestrati su passi temporali grossolani di generalizzare a dinamiche a risoluzione fine. L'articolo effettua un benchmark di tre metodi di apprendimento di operatori su un semplice sistema di prova, valutando la capacità di super-risoluzione a zero shot e la generalizzazione tra meccanismi dinamici stabili e instabili.

Contesto di Ricerca e Motivazione

Contesto del Problema

  1. Collo di bottiglia computazionale: La simulazione nel dominio del tempo di reti con elevata penetrazione di energie rinnovabili richiede passi temporali estremamente piccoli di 1-50 microsecondi per catturare i fenomeni dinamici ultrarapidi correlati agli inverter, rendendo la simulazione a livello di sistema computazionalmente non fattibile
  2. Esigenze pratiche: Eventi come il blackout della Spagna e del Portogallo di aprile 2025 evidenziano l'urgente necessità di strumenti di analisi in tempo reale scalabili
  3. Cambiamento climatico: Superare gli ostacoli computazionali è essenziale per l'integrazione stabile delle energie rinnovabili richiesta dalle politiche di mitigazione dei cambiamenti climatici

Limitazioni dei Metodi Esistenti

  1. Approcci basati su classificatori: Possono solo determinare lo stato di stabilità del sistema, non possono essere utilizzati come modelli surrogati per la simulazione nel dominio del tempo e non sono applicabili alla progettazione del controllo
  2. Approcci di sostituzione di componenti: Richiedono interfacce complesse per integrare componenti di apprendimento automatico nelle equazioni differenziali del resto del sistema
  3. Modelli surrogati a livello di sistema completo: Richiedono un addestramento, una validazione e test di generalizzazione estensivi

Contributi Principali

  1. Prima proposta del concetto di invarianza del passo temporale: Consente ai modelli addestrati su passi temporali grossolani di generalizzare a dinamiche a risoluzione fine
  2. Benchmark di super-risoluzione a zero shot: Confronta le prestazioni di tre metodi di apprendimento di operatori sulla generalizzazione di super-risoluzione a zero shot
  3. Analisi di generalizzazione dei meccanismi di stabilità: Analizza la capacità dei modelli di generalizzare tra meccanismi dinamici stabili e instabili
  4. Percorso per l'integrazione delle energie rinnovabili: Supporta l'integrazione stabile delle energie rinnovabili attraverso strumenti di analisi scalabili e computazionalmente fattibili

Dettagli Metodologici

Definizione del Compito

Apprendere l'operatore G che mappa la traiettoria iniziale t ∈ 0, τ alla traiettoria futura desiderata t ∈ τi, T generata da equazioni differenziali ordinarie.

Tre Metodi di Apprendimento di Operatori

1. Deep Operator Networks (DeepONets)

  • Architettura: Utilizza due rami di reti neurali
    • Ramo di ramo elabora la traiettoria di input
    • Ramo principale codifica il tempo di query di output
  • Output: Produce il valore della traiettoria predetta combinando gli output dei due rami attraverso un prodotto interno

2. Fourier Neural Operators (FNOs)

  • Idea centrale: Proietta l'input sulla base di Fourier, applica moltiplicatori spettrali appresi, quindi trasforma di nuovo nel dominio del tempo
  • Vantaggi: La rappresentazione spettrale può catturare la struttura temporale liscia e supportare variazioni di risoluzione
  • Miglioramento: Utilizza la tensorizzazione per ridurre il numero di parametri mantenendo la precisione

3. Latent Neural ODEs (LNODEs)

  • Architettura: Struttura encoder-decoder
    • Codifica la traiettoria di input in uno stato latente
    • Evolve lo stato latente attraverso una ODE neurale
    • Decodifica nello spazio originale
  • Risolutore: Valuta risolutori a passo fisso (Adams) e a passo adattivo (Dormand-Prince-Shampine)

Sistema di Prova SMIB

Utilizza un sistema Single Machine Infinite Bus (SMIB), costituito da un generatore sincrono collegato attraverso una linea di trasmissione a una fonte rigida. La dinamica dell'angolo del rotore del generatore è controllata dall'equazione:

2δt2=πf0H(PmDδtEVXsinδ)\frac{\partial^2\delta}{\partial t^2} = \frac{\pi f_0}{H}\left(P_m - D\frac{\partial\delta}{\partial t} - \frac{|E||V|}{X}\sin\delta\right)

dove δ(t) è l'angolo del rotore, Pm è la potenza meccanica di input, D è il coefficiente di smorzamento, E e V sono le tensioni, X è la reattanza della linea di trasmissione, H è la costante di inerzia e f0 è la frequenza nominale.

Configurazione Sperimentale

Generazione dei Dati

  • Campionamento dei parametri: Pm ~ U0, 2, D ~ 0.0, 0.135
  • Traiettorie stabili: Pm1 ~ U0.0, Pmax_m1, dove Pmax_m1 è determinato dalle equazioni (2)(3)
  • Traiettorie instabili: Utilizza ricerca binaria di 100 iterazioni per approssimare il limite inferiore
  • Scala dei dati: 8000 traiettorie di addestramento e 1000 traiettorie di validazione per ogni dataset
  • Finestra temporale: Sequenza di input t ∈ 0, 0.2s, sequenza target t ∈ 0.3, 3.1s

Addestramento del Modello

  • Ottimizzazione degli iperparametri: 120 prove di ottimizzazione bayesiana
  • Numero di parametri: Circa 700.000 parametri per tutti i modelli per garantire un confronto equo
  • Funzione di perdita: Perdita della norma di Sobolev H1
  • Epoche di addestramento: 60 epoche per LNODE e FNO, 600 epoche per DeepONet

Metriche di Valutazione

  • Super-risoluzione a zero shot: RMSE e percentuale di degradazione delle prestazioni
  • Generalizzazione dei meccanismi dinamici: Errore medio assoluto in scala (Mean Absolute Scaled Error)

Risultati Sperimentali

Risultati di Super-risoluzione a Zero Shot

ModelloΔt=100ms (RMSE)Δt=50μs (RMSE)Degradazione (%)
DeepONet0.0220±0.00010.0348±0.000245.2
FNO0.0186±0.00010.0302±0.000147.5
LNODE (Fisso)0.0280±0.00060.0305±0.00068.6
LNODE (Adattivo)0.0275±0.00030.0296±0.00037.3

Risultati Principali

  1. LNODE ha le migliori prestazioni: Nel compito di super-risoluzione a zero shot, LNODE raggiunge la minima degradazione delle prestazioni
  2. Prestazioni assolute eccellenti di FNO: A risoluzione di addestramento originale, FNO ha l'RMSE più basso, ma la degradazione delle prestazioni ad alta risoluzione è la più grande
  3. Differenze significative nella capacità di generalizzazione: La degradazione delle prestazioni di LNODE è solo dell'8.6% e del 7.3%, mentre DeepONet e FNO superano entrambi il 45%

Generalizzazione dei Meccanismi Dinamici

  • Impatto dei dati di addestramento: I modelli addestrati solo su traiettorie stabili hanno difficoltà a generalizzare alle regioni instabili
  • Effetto dell'addestramento misto: I dati di addestramento contenenti il 20% di traiettorie instabili consentono a tutti i metodi di catturare la dinamica della regione instabile
  • Vantaggio di DeepONet: Nell'addestramento misto, DeepONet è l'unico metodo che mantiene prestazioni simili nella regione stabile

Lavori Correlati

Classificazione dei Metodi di Apprendimento Automatico per Sistemi Elettrici

  1. Metodi basati su classificatori: Determinano lo stato di stabilità del sistema e i margini di stabilità, ma non possono essere utilizzati come modelli surrogati
  2. Metodi di modellazione surrogata:
    • Sostituzione di componenti: Approssima le equazioni differenziali di singoli componenti con modelli
    • Modellazione a livello di sistema completo: Progetta modelli surrogati data-driven per l'intero sistema (metodo di questo articolo)

Applicazioni dell'Apprendimento di Operatori nei Sistemi Elettrici

  • ODE Neurali: Utilizzate per modellare componenti indipendenti di sistemi elettrici
  • DeepONet: Applicate alla modellazione di sistemi elettrici dopo perturbazioni
  • FNO: Prima applicazione nella modellazione di sistemi elettrici

Conclusioni e Discussione

Conclusioni Principali

  1. Invarianza del passo temporale fattibile: I metodi di apprendimento di operatori possono realizzare la generalizzazione da passi temporali grossolani a passi temporali fini
  2. Differenze di prestazioni dei metodi: LNODE ha le migliori prestazioni nella super-risoluzione a zero shot, FNO eccelle nella precisione assoluta
  3. Importanza dei dati di addestramento: I dati di addestramento misto contenenti traiettorie sia stabili che instabili sono cruciali per la generalizzazione

Limitazioni

  1. Complessità del sistema: Il sistema SMIB è troppo semplice e non cattura la dinamica complessa delle reti con elevata penetrazione di energie rinnovabili
  2. Verifica della praticità: È necessaria una modellazione e un test completi su sistemi di prova reali
  3. Confronto dei metodi: Sono necessari più test per verificare la competitività dei metodi con diversi bias induttivi

Direzioni Future

  1. Modellazione di sistemi complessi: Estensione a reti reali con elevata penetrazione di energie rinnovabili
  2. Test pratici: Verifica dell'efficacia dei metodi su sistemi elettrici reali
  3. Miglioramenti algoritmici: Esplorazione di bias induttivi migliori e progettazioni architettoniche

Valutazione Approfondita

Punti di Forza

  1. Forte innovazione: Prima introduzione del concetto di invarianza del passo temporale nella simulazione di sistemi elettrici
  2. Problema importante: Risolve il collo di bottiglia computazionale critico nell'integrazione delle energie rinnovabili
  3. Metodo completo: Confronto sistematico di tre metodi principali di apprendimento di operatori
  4. Progettazione sperimentale razionale: Valutazione completa della super-risoluzione a zero shot e della generalizzazione dei meccanismi dinamici
  5. Significato sociale: Serve direttamente agli obiettivi di mitigazione dei cambiamenti climatici

Carenze

  1. Sistema di prova semplice: Il sistema SMIB non riflette la complessità delle reti elettriche reali
  2. Capacità di generalizzazione limitata: La generalizzazione tra meccanismi dinamici rimane difficile
  3. Analisi teorica insufficiente: Mancanza di garanzie teoriche per l'invarianza del passo temporale
  4. Praticità da verificare: È necessaria la verifica su sistemi reali su larga scala

Impatto

  1. Contributo accademico: Apre una nuova direzione di apprendimento automatico per la simulazione di sistemi elettrici
  2. Valore pratico: Fornisce un percorso per risolvere le sfide computazionali nell'integrazione delle energie rinnovabili
  3. Riproducibilità: Fornisce un repository GitHub per facilitare la ricerca successiva

Scenari Applicabili

  1. Simulazione rapida di sistemi elettrici: Scenari che richiedono analisi in tempo reale o quasi in tempo reale
  2. Integrazione di energie rinnovabili: Analisi di stabilità di reti con elevata penetrazione di energie rinnovabili
  3. Modellazione multi-risoluzione: Sistemi complessi che richiedono modellazione su scale temporali diverse

Riferimenti Bibliografici

L'articolo cita 25 articoli correlati, coprendo importanti lavori in più campi tra cui teoria dell'apprendimento di operatori, modellazione di sistemi elettrici e metodi di apprendimento automatico, fornendo una base teorica solida per la ricerca.


Valutazione Complessiva: Questo è un lavoro di importanza pionieristica nel campo della simulazione di sistemi elettrici, che sebbene attualmente verificato solo su sistemi semplici, fornisce nuove idee e metodi per affrontare le sfide tecniche critiche nell'integrazione delle energie rinnovabili. La proposta del concetto di invarianza del passo temporale ha un valore teorico e pratico significativo e merita ulteriori ricerche e applicazioni estese.